Case
Study - Yousef Khanfar
Photographer: Yousef
Khanfar - New York
Project: Scans
and Custom Files for his book, "In Search of Peace" and
his accompanying exhibition.
Camera/Film: Large
Format 4X5 Linhof Master Technica camera with three lenses:
75mm; 210mm; and 360mm.
Fuji Velvia film.
Goal: Khanfar
wanted to ensure consistent print quality in both his book and
his fine art prints.
Solution:
Turning to West Coast Imaging for excellent scans, with printmaker
Terrance Reimer interpreting his images for prints
and CMYK files for his book.
In
Khanfar's Words:
"Photography
can rise to the most sublime moments of humanity. After Sept 11,
2001, I wanted to create an uplifting message of hope and peace to
mankind using landscape as my metaphor for maximum personal and artistic
expression.
When
the time came to publish my new book, In Search of Peace,
I wanted to make sure that this body of work was consistent in
print quality in both the book and the exhibition. So, I looked
to my partner West Coast Imaging, who has done an excellent
job in the scanning and interpretation of my images, making
sure that the beauty of the images, as I captured it on the original
film, is expressed as a true fine art print.
Last
year I was delighted that my book was the winner of the 2007
Independent Publisher Outstanding Book of the Year. I was also
as delighted that Mont Blanc and UNICEF selected me one of the
artists of the year to help raise funds to fight illiteracy around
the world, which is something I believe in strongly. I still
contribute this success to paying attention to quality."
